What causes the screen to go blank ?
 
If you still have some functions - radio still works, etc., Then it may be a cold solder joint I've heard is a problem. The screen going blank happened to my 04 LC so I sent it in for repair. They didn't tell me what was wrong with mine but it's been re-installed and working.

You could probably locate a replacement screen for your OEM unit. When i replaced my screen I had to disassemble the unit to be able to get the exact model number for the screen so the replacement screen would be compatible. The screen is more than likely manufactured by Toshiba
